Vintage Prince Piano Model III Desk Lighter (Japan, ca. 1940–1950) – Perfectly Functional

A rare post-war collectible mechanical desk lighter in the shape of a miniature frame piano, made by the renowned Japanese brand Prince.

Make and Model: PRINCE PIANO MODEL III (clearly marked on the top metal plate)

Origin: Made in Japan

Period: Late 1940s – early 1950s

Materials: Cream-colored Bakelite/plastic body with cast metal support legs and chrome-plated metal top cover decorated with fine floral engravings.

Activation Mechanism: Automatic gasoline and flint ignition, triggered by pressing the piano keys.

Special Features: The large lid is hinged and snaps open with the original stem, revealing the internal brass sheet music holder cut in the shape of a fleur-de-lis.

Condition and Function:

Aesthetics: Excellent vintage condition and complete. All original elements (Prince Piano III model plate, ornamental engravings and the internal sheet music holder) are perfectly preserved and intact. The keys show a fine natural patina, typical of their age.

Function: The mechanism is tested and fully functional. When the keys are pressed, the upper flap automatically rises and the lighter produces a stable flame. A special piece, ready for use or direct display in a top collection.
